The Evolution of USB Standards

USB, short for Universal Serial Bus, was introduced to standardize the connection of computer peripherals. Over the years, this technology has evolved dramatically, with each new version bringing enhancements in speed, power delivery, and functionality.

A Brief History

  • USB 1.0/1.1: Introduced in 1996, offering speeds up to 12 Mbps.
  • USB 2.0: Released in 2000, increasing speeds to 480 Mbps.
  • USB 3.0 and 3.1: Launched in 2008 and 2013, respectively, with speeds up to 5 Gbps and 10 Gbps.
  • USB 3.2: Released in 2017, offering speeds up to 20 Gbps.
  • USB4: Announced in 2019, it supports speeds up to 40 Gbps, matching Thunderbolt 3.

Understanding USB4

USB4 is more than just another iteration in the USB family. It's a significant leap forward in terms of speed, power, and versatility. Developed on the Thunderbolt 3 protocol, USB4 brings several advancements that make it worth considering.

Key Features of USB4

  • High-Speed Data Transfer: With speeds reaching up to 40 Gbps, transferring large files, such as 4K video, becomes a breeze.
  • Dual-Channel Mode: Allows simultaneous data and display connections without compromising performance.
  • Power Delivery: Capable of delivering up to 100W, sufficient for charging laptops and other power-hungry devices.
  • Backward Compatibility: Works seamlessly with USB 3.2 and USB 2.0, ensuring you don't need to replace all your existing devices.
  • Support for Multiple Protocols: USB4 supports Display Port, PCIe, and Thunderbolt 3, offering a wide range of connectivity options.

Common Pitfalls and Solutions

Not All Cables Are Created Equal

Not every USB4 cable is the same. Some are designed for data transfer, while others prioritize power delivery. Ensure you're purchasing a cable that meets your specific needs. A simple way to verify this is by checking the cable's specifications, usually printed on the packaging or in the product description.

Compatibility Issues

While USB4 is backward compatible, not all devices support all the features of USB4. For example, a USB4 cable will physically connect to a USB 2.0 port, but you won't get the speed benefits. Always check your device's specifications to ensure compatibility.

USB4 Version 2.0

Announced in late 2022, USB4 Version 2.0 promises to double the data transfer speed to 80 Gbps. This will be a game-changer for industries relying on quick data transfers, such as film production and scientific research.
